Pepper spray is a chemical agent which is used in riot control and personal self-defense. The active ingredient in pepper spray is capsaicin, which is a chemical derived from cayenne, paprika, or chilies. Also known as OC spray (from "Oleoresin Capsicum") or OC gas, pepper spray has been linked to over 100 fatalities in the USA, as well as miscarriages, birth defects, and siezures.
